Criminal Mischief Reported in Eldred Township

ELDRED TOWNSHIP, Pa. (EYT) – According to Marienville-based State Police, sometime between 11:00 p.m. on September 14 and 8:00 a.m. on September 15, an incident of Criminal Mischief occurred on the west side of State Route 36, 1/2 mile north of Bottom Road, in Eldred Township, Jefferson County.

Police say an unknown perpetrator(s) drove a vehicle onto a 51-year-old Brookville man’s property and proceeded to “turf” his lawn leaving several deep ruts.

The perpetrator(s) fled the scene in an unknown direction.

No other details were provided.
